#ifndef _SYS_TRAP_H
#define _SYS_TRAP_H
#ifdef __cplusplus
extern "C" {
#endif
/*
* Trap type values
*/
#define T_ZERODIV 0x0 /* #de divide by 0 error */
#define T_SGLSTP 0x1 /* #db single step */
#define T_NMIFLT 0x2 /* NMI */
#define T_BPTFLT 0x3 /* #bp breakpoint fault, INT3 insn */
#define T_OVFLW 0x4 /* #of INTO overflow fault */
#define T_BOUNDFLT 0x5 /* #br BOUND insn fault */
#define T_ILLINST 0x6 /* #ud invalid opcode fault */
#define T_NOEXTFLT 0x7 /* #nm device not available: x87 */
#define T_DBLFLT 0x8 /* #df double fault */
#define T_EXTOVRFLT 0x9 /* [not generated: 386 only] */
#define T_TSSFLT 0xa /* #ts invalid TSS fault */
#define T_SEGFLT 0xb /* #np segment not present fault */
#define T_STKFLT 0xc /* #ss stack fault */
#define T_GPFLT 0xd /* #gp general protection fault */
#define T_PGFLT 0xe /* #pf page fault */
#define T_RESVTRAP 0xf /* reserved */
#define T_EXTERRFLT 0x10 /* #mf x87 FPU error fault */
#define T_ALIGNMENT 0x11 /* #ac alignment check error */
#define T_MCE 0x12 /* #mc machine check exception */
#define T_SIMDFPE 0x13 /* #xm SSE/SSE exception */
#define T_DBGENTR 0x14 /* debugger entry */
#define T_INVALTRAP 0x1e /* invalid */
#define T_ENDPERR 0x21 /* emulated extension error flt */
#define T_ENOEXTFLT 0x20 /* emulated ext not present */
#define T_FASTTRAP 0xd2 /* fast system call */
#define T_SYSCALLINT 0x91 /* general system call */
#define T_DTRACE_RET 0x92 /* DTrace pid return */
#define T_INT80 0x80 /* int80 handler for linux emulation */
#define T_SOFTINT 0x50fd /* pseudo softint trap type */
/*
* Pseudo traps.
*/
#define T_INTERRUPT 0x100
#define T_FAULT 0x200
#define T_AST 0x400
#define T_SYSCALL 0x180
/*
* Values of error code on stack in case of page fault
*/
#define PF_ERR_MASK 0x01 /* Mask for error bit */
#define PF_ERR_PAGE 0x00 /* page not present */
#define PF_ERR_PROT 0x01 /* protection error */
#define PF_ERR_WRITE 0x02 /* fault caused by write (else read) */
#define PF_ERR_USER 0x04 /* processor was in user mode */
/* (else supervisor) */
#define PF_ERR_EXEC 0x10 /* attempt to execute a No eXec page (AMD) */
/* or kernel tried to execute a user page */
/* (Intel SMEP) */
/*
* Definitions for fast system call subfunctions
*/
#define T_FNULL 0 /* Null trap for testing */
#define T_FGETFP 1 /* Get emulated FP context */
#define T_FSETFP 2 /* Set emulated FP context */
#define T_GETHRTIME 3 /* Get high resolution time */
#define T_GETHRVTIME 4 /* Get high resolution virtual time */
#define T_GETHRESTIME 5 /* Get high resolution time */
#define T_GETLGRP 6 /* Get home lgrpid */
#define T_LASTFAST 6 /* Last valid subfunction */
/*
* Offsets for an interrupt/trap frame.
*/
#define T_FRAME_ERR 0
#define T_FRAME_RIP 8
#define T_FRAME_CS 16
#define T_FRAME_RFLAGS 24
#define T_FRAME_RSP 32
#define T_FRAME_SS 40
#define T_FRAMERET_RIP 0
#define T_FRAMERET_CS 8
#define T_FRAMERET_RFLAGS 16
#define T_FRAMERET_RSP 24
#define T_FRAMERET_SS 32
#ifdef __cplusplus
}
#endif
#endif /* _SYS_TRAP_H */
